Transaction 4aff57895ef24e87035e933835eea829d00705d42bf002a8943ed9ef22b8f716
1 Input
2 Outputs
- 4aff57895ef24e87035e933835eea829d00705d42bf002a8943ed9ef22b8f716:0
- 4aff57895ef24e87035e933835eea829d00705d42bf002a8943ed9ef22b8f716:1
value 181535
address 37WdMVf6HWDyHkxkN4YK93z72mqDkiMsXF
value 251036
address 3J5T89PTPK3bzUfn6AXt4XjhT8RdDdLxaK